Kaixu Wang (王凯旭) has been competing for 8 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 12.45, set at Inner Mongolia Winter 2019, puts him in the top 15.5%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 6,068th in China. Across 2 competitions since October 2018, he has put 44 official solves on the record across four events. His 3×3 best has come down from 13.88 in October 2018 to 12.45, a 10% improvement.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
